This morning at Brno, Czech Republic, the Clash MMA 15 event was marred by a chaotic incident that shocked fans and the international MMA community. In a tense close grappling moment, fighter Pavol Vasko bit the ear of opponent Václav Mikulášek. The referee immediately intervened and disqualified Pavol Vasko on the spot. After the fight, angry fans chased and assaulted Vasko as he was being escorted out, causing severe violence. Security failed to fully prevent the assault despite using shields. Pavol Vasko was disqualified for the biting foul during grappling. Václav Mikulášek required 28 stitches for his ear injury.
